1. In a large bowl, whisk together the oats,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t.
2. In a medium bowl, combine the peanut butter, egg, vanilla, and honey. Whisk until blended.
3. Scrape the liquid mixture into the oat mixture and stir just until combined. The dough will be wet and sticky. Fold in the chocolate chips. Place in the refrigerator and let chill for at least 30 minutes or up to 3 days.
4. When ready to bake, place a rack in the center of your oven and pre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Line a large rimmed ba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one baking sheet. Remove the dough from the refrigerator (if it is very stiff, you may need to let it sit out for 5 to 10 minutes). With a cookie scoop or spoon, drop the dough into 2-inch balls and arrange on the baking sheet, leaving 1 inch of space around each. With your fingers, gently flatten each cookie to be about 3/4-inch thick.

1. Preheat your oven on 180'C/350'F and line a baking tray with a sheet of baking paper or a baking mat.
2. In a large mixing bowl, finely mash the Ripe Bananas until smooth. Add the Peanut Butter (and optionally, the Ground Cinnamon and/or Vanilla Extract). Whisk together until combined.
3. Add the Oats and mix with a spatula or wooden spoon until all the oats are evenly covered with the peanut butter/mashed bananas.
4. With a small Ice Cream Scoop (see note 1), scoop out small dollops of cookie batter onto the baking tray. Gently flatten the cookies with your fingers.

1. Pre-heat oven to 350 F.
2. Mash the bananas in a bowl with a fork until they form a thick, smooth paste.
3. Add the rest of the ingredients and mix until everything is combined into a dough.
4. Drop 16 spoonfuls onto a cookie sheet, shaping each spoonful into a cookie shape. The cookies will not change shape during baking, so make sure you create the cookie shape you want beforehand. You can make them larger and flatter or keep them as more of a haystack-style.
